Tripura Government Prioritizes Peaceful Coexistence, says Chief Minister Manik Saha
In a strong assertion of the state’s commitment to communal harmony, Chief Minister Manik Saha reiterated that his government is prioritizing the peaceful coexistence of people from both tribal and non-tribal communities. Speaking exclusively to ANI, Saha emphasized that one of the primary goals of his administration is to ensure the overall welfare of every section of the society.
Saha made these remarks after attending the Ram Navami Utsav at Sri Saibaba Temple in Agartala, Tripura. He emphasized that the state’s progress hinges on the peaceful coexistence of people from all castes and tribes. Noting that problems can arise, Saha assured that his government will resolve any issues through dialogue and swift action. “We have demonstrated this not just in words, but also through actions,” he said.
Saha also highlighted the significance of faith in the state’s population, particularly among women. He noted that mothers and sisters have unwavering faith in religion, and this belief inspires the government to work towards bringing smiles to people’s faces. The chief minister’s remarksecho the state’s commitment to religious harmony and tolerance.
In a separate development, Saha recently emphasized the government’s commitment to honoring the contributions of individuals who have elevated the state’s reputation through their exceptional work. He underscored the importance of ensuring that their legacies are not forgotten, citing the example of Bipul Kanti Saha, the pioneer of modern sculpture in Tripura. “Such personalities can never be forgotten, and they will inspire the next generation to move forward,” Saha said.
